[Nick Stracke](https://twitter.com/nickstracke_), [Stefan Andreas Baumann](https://stefan-baumann.eu/), [Joshua Susskind](https://twitter.com/jsusskin), [Miguel Angel Bautista](https://twitter.com/itsbautistam), [Björn Ommer](https://ommer-lab.com/people/ommer/) We present LoRAdapter, an approach that unifies both style and structure conditioning under the same formulation using a novel conditional LoRA block that enables zero-shot control. LoRAdapter is an efficient, powerful, and architecture-agnostic approach to condition text-to-image diffusion models, which enables fine-grained control conditioning during generation and outperforms recent state-of-the-art approaches. ## 🎓 Citation If you use this codebase or otherwise found our work valuable, please cite our paper: ```bibtex @misc{stracke2024loradapter, title={CTRLorALTer: Conditional LoRAdapter for Efficient 0-Shot Control & Altering of T2I Models}, author={Nick Stracke and Stefan Andreas Baumann and Joshua Susskind and Miguel Angel Bautista and Björn Ommer}, year={2024}, eprint={2405.07913}, archivePrefix={arXiv}, primaryClass={cs.CV} } ```
